Understanding Loose Skin After Weight Loss
Losing a significant amount of weight is a major achievement. But for many people, the journey doesn’t end with the number on the scale. One of the most common issues people face after weight loss is loose, sagging skin. This can happen to anyone—especially if the weight loss was rapid or occurred later in life, when skin has less elasticity.
Loose skin can be uncomfortable and affect how your clothes fit. For some, it can also lead to skin irritation or hygiene issues. More importantly, it can be emotionally frustrating. After working so hard to improve your health, you want your body to look the way you feel.

What Is BodyTite?
BodyTite is a minimally invasive skin tightening procedure that uses radiofrequency-assisted lipolysis (RFAL) to both melt fat and tighten skin. The goal is to give you a smoother, more toned appearance without the need for major surgery.
Unlike traditional liposuction, which only removes fat, BodyTite goes a step further by addressing the loose skin that often remains behind. It works by applying controlled heat under the skin, which stimulates collagen production—the natural protein that keeps your skin firm and elastic.
How Does BodyTite Work?
During a BodyTite procedure:
- A small incision is made to allow a thin probe to go under the skin.
- The device emits radiofrequency waves that heat the area from the inside.
- This heat melts away small fat pockets while triggering the skin to tighten.
- The process also encourages new collagen growth over time.
It’s performed under local anesthesia or light sedation, and most people go home the same day. Recovery is quicker and less intense than with traditional surgery.
Who Is the Ideal Candidate for BodyTite?
BodyTite is best for people who have:
- Mild to moderate skin laxity
- Small areas of stubborn fat
- Good overall health
- Realistic expectations
It’s especially helpful for those who’ve lost 20 to 60 pounds and are dealing with areas like the stomach, arms, thighs, or neck. However, if someone has already lost a significant amount of elasticity, such as from losing over 100 pounds or aging skin, surgery like a tummy tuck may be more effective.
How Long Do the Results Last?
Most people begin to see visible results within 3 to 6 months, with continued improvement for up to a year as new collagen forms. While the fat removal is permanent, the skin-tightening effects depend on maintaining a stable weight and a healthy lifestyle.
Results can last several years, especially when combined with regular skincare and exercise. Though it doesn’t stop aging, BodyTite can help delay the need for more invasive procedures.
BodyTite vs. Other Skin Tightening Options
There are many treatments on the market, but not all are created equal. Here’s how BodyTite compares:
BodyTite vs. Non-Invasive RF or Laser Treatments
Non-invasive treatments like Thermage or Ultherapy work from the outside in. While they can improve skin tightness, the results are usually more subtle and often require multiple sessions. BodyTite’s internal heat application typically leads to stronger and longer-lasting results.
BodyTite vs. Surgery
Surgical methods like tummy tucks or arm lifts offer dramatic results but come with significant downtime, risks, and scars. BodyTite offers a middle ground—more noticeable results than non-invasive treatments, with less recovery than surgery.
What Are the Risks and Side Effects?
As with any procedure, there are some risks. The most common side effects include:
- Swelling and bruising
- Temporary numbness
- Mild discomfort
Less common but more serious complications could include burns, infection, or changes in skin texture if not performed by a skilled provider. That’s why it's essential to choose a qualified, experienced practitioner.
The Cost of BodyTite
BodyTite is an investment. The cost varies depending on the treatment area and the provider's expertise, but it generally ranges from $2,500 to $7,500 per area.
